Natalie's Orchid Island Juice Introduced a New Product

Ahead of National Margarita Day, which fell on February 22nd, Natalie's Orchid Island Juice Company introduced a three-ingredient Margarita Mix that is bound to capture the attention of consumers looking to elevate their home cocktail experience.

The clean-label Margarita Mix includes a blend of fresh limes, pure cane sugar, and water. The recipe aligns with Natalie's Orchid Island Juice Company's commitment to quality and mindful sourcing. With its versatile and natural taste, the three-ingredient Margarita Mix lends itself to a variety of recipes—from classic cocktails to innovative twists.

Natalie's Orchid Island Juice Company emphasizes that its Margarita Mix also carries health benefits such as phytonutrients and Vitamin C from fresh limes. The mix contains no preservatives, artificial ingredients, or GMOs
